Different substances expand in volume when heated. This applies to solids, liquids and gases as well.

The most obvious example of the expansion of liquids when heated, when no experiment is needed, is a thermometer. The alcohol or mercury of the thermometer, when heated, rises up the scale until it reaches a certain equilibrium and stops.

Take a small medicine bottle or bottle, preferably with a screw cap. Make a thin hole in the cork and insert a clean ballpoint pen into it. The place where the rod entered the cork, coat with plasticine. With a pipette, fill the rod with soapy water (such water with diluted soap, as is usually done for blowing soap bubbles). Dip the vial or bottle into a glass of hot water. Now, from the outer end of the rod, small soap bubbles will begin to rise - one by one. Each new bubble knocks down the previous one, and, finally, one remains, which arose "on its last breath." It is quite firmly held on the end of the rod. Bubbles appeared from the expansion of air in the bottle when it was heated with water.

Expansion when heated

Let's do an experiment with the expansion from heating a solid object. It would be nice to find a metal ball from billiards or from a ball bearing. By its size, look for some kind of metal plate with a hole. If the diameter of the hole is smaller than the ball, widen it with a round file. Make sure that the ball, if it is placed on the hole, falls through without lingering in it. But there should be no gap between the ball and the hole.

Put the ball on the hot plate. If the stove is gas, then put it on a metal circle that every housewife has to protect some dishes from burning. When the ball heats up well, take it with pliers and quickly put it on the hole in the plate, previously fixed above the metal box. The ball will increase in size from heating and will stay in the hole until it cools. When it cools down, it will slide right through it. (Note that the ball will darken from strong heating, so you need to take a ball that you don’t mind spoiling.)

Expansion when heated

The fact that the size of an object changes when heated should be well remembered when pouring hot water into a cold glass or jar. If you immediately pour boiling water into a glass dish, then the glass, expanding, will burst. Therefore, always, before pouring hot water, you need to prepare the dishes, rinse them with less hot water so that the glass heats up gradually.

Sharp Smart Glasses with Spectacles Camera 24.04.2018

Snap, owner of the social networking site Snapchat, has unveiled the second generation of its Spectacles camera smart glasses. This device was first released in November 2016. The new gadget is capable of recording videos of 10 or 30 seconds in length with a resolution of 1216 x 1216 pixels at 60 frames per second.

A photo mode has also appeared, which was absent in the first generation device. Pictures can be taken with a resolution of 1642x1642 pixels. Another innovation is the moisture protection of the case. The devices are presented in new colors - Ruby, Onyx and Sapphire.

The smart glasses are equipped with two microphones for sound recording and 4 GB of permanent memory for storing footage. There are also modules Bluetooth 4.0 and Wi-Fi 802.11ac (2,4/5 GHz).

The novelty is priced at $150.
